# Building Access — Mail Room Move

The Pellwick Tower mail room has relocated from B1 to Level 3 East, next to the Harrow Stairs. Old B1 pigeonholes are decommissioned. Route all courier pickups to Level 3 from Monday. Assistants collecting team post need the east-wing door pass. Trolleys stay in the alcove by the lifts. Questions go to the Fenbrook Facilities desk on Level 1. The east-wing door pass code is below.

staff pass of kawip-hawef = bdg-QLP-2

Runbook 6.3 — Recalled Charger Pallet (Office Manager)

The pallet of recalled Voltbridge chargers in bay three must not re-enter stock. It is shrink-wrapped, tagged with recall notices, and logged as quarantined. No units may be removed, even as spares. Collection is arranged with Drayhall Freight for the Monday run; the driver will present a recall collection slip matching our reference. Confirm the count against the slip before release. The courier hand-over instruction is given below.

handover note for yagef-bagep: the drudor pelius courier leaves the kasdor zorvan norir ledger at gate 8016 under passcode 755406

Welcome aboard! Quick note on TrailMark's offline mode before you cut the next release. Field crews in the Verro Basin often lose signal for hours, so the app queues survey entries locally and syncs when coverage returns. The sync worker needs a signing credential to authenticate queued batches — without it, everything silently piles up on device. Before tagging the build, open the staging env file and make sure this line is present.

env line for baguf-fajop: VAULT_KEY29=55a9f564d54882bbe7acf5741bf1a

# User Module Split — Provenance Notes

For reviewers of the Lanternworks monolith decomposition: the extracted user module now builds as a standalone artifact. The pipeline signs each build, embeds the source revision, and rejects unsigned dependencies. Diff the generated manifest against main before approving. The canonical identifier for the artifact under review appears directly below.

session token of tajef-bageg = htk21_5d90d574934f3ccae6437